Spelling suggestions: "subject:"workflow net interorganizational"" "subject:"workflow net interorganizacionais""
1 |
Detecção e correção de situações de deadlock em workflow nets interorganizacionaisSilva, Luciane de Fátima 03 February 2014 (has links)
In this work, an approach based on Deadlock avoidance of Interorganizational Work-Flow nets is proposed to deal with these situations. Interorganizational business processes
are modeled by Interorganizational WorkFlow nets. Deadlock situations in interorganizational
business processes come generally related to losses during message
exchanges between several business processes. Within the Petri net theory, a Deadlock
situation is characterized by the presence of a siphon that can be empty. After detecting
and controlling the Siphon structures that lead to Deadlock situations in Interorganizational
WorkFlow nets, a method for the design of Interorganizational WorkFlow nets
free of Deadlock is proposed. In particular, the basic principle is to dene new Work-
Flow nets shared among the original work
ow processes that allow one to remove the
scenarios responsible for the Deadlocks. / Neste trabalho e proposta uma abordagem baseada na prevenção de deadlocks em
WorkFlow nets Interorganizacionais para lidar com situações dessa natureza. Processos
de negocio interorganizacionais são modelados por work
ows interorganizacionais.
Situações de deadlock nos processos de negocio interorganizacionais geralmente estão
relacionadas a perdas durante trocas de mensagens entre varios processos de negocio.
Dentro da teoria das redes de Petri, uma situação de deadlock e caracterizada pela
presenca de um sifão que pode car vazio. Depois de detectar e controlar as estruturas de sifão que levam as situações de deadlock nas WorkFlow nets Interorganizacionais, e
proposta uma arquitetura distribuda para modelar as WorkFlow nets Interorganizacionais
livre de deadlock. Em particular, o princpio basico consiste em denir novas
WorkFlow nets compartilhadas entre os work
ows originais que permitem remover os
cenarios responsaveis pelos deadlocks. / Mestre em Ciência da Computação
|
2 |
Uma metodologia baseada na lógica linear para análise de processos de workflow interorganizacionaisPassos, Lígia Maria Soares 22 February 2016 (has links)
Coordenação de Aperfeiçoamento de Pessoal de Nível Superior / This work formalizes four methods based on Linear Logic for the verification of interorganizational
workflow processes modelled by Interorganizational Workflow nets, which
are Petri nets that model such processes. The first method is related to the verification of
the Soundness criteria for interorganizational workflow processes. The method is based on
the construction and analysis of Linear Logic proof trees, which represent the local processes
as much as they do the global processes. The second and third methods are related,
respectively to Soundness criteria verification, Relaxed Soundness and Weak Soundness
for the interorganizational workflow processes. These are obtained through the analysis
of reutilized Linear Logic proof trees that have been constructed for the verification of
the Soundness criteria. However, the fourth method has the objective of detecting the
deadlock free scenarios in interorganizational workflow and is based on the construction
and analysis of Linear Logic proof trees, which initially takes into consideration the local
processes and communication between such, and thereafter the candidate scenarios. A
case study is carried out in the context of a Web services composition check, since there
is a close correlation between the modelling of the interorganizational workflow process
and a Web services composition. Therefore, the four methods proposed in the interorganizational
workflow process context, are applied to a Web services composition. The
evaluation of the obtained results shows that the reutilization of Linear Logic proof trees
initially constructed for verifying the Soundness criteria, in fact occurs in the context of
verifying the Relaxed Soundness andWeak Soundness criteria. In addition, the evaluation
shows how the Linear Logic sequents and their proof trees explicitly show the possibilities
for existing collaborations in a Web service composition. An evaluation that takes into
account the number of constructed linear logic proof trees shows that this number can
be significantly reduced in the deadlock-freeness scenarios detection method. An approach
for resource planning based on the symbolic date calculation, which considers data
extracted from Linear Logic proof trees is presented and validated through simulations performed on the CPN tools simulator. Two approaches for the monitoring of deadlockfreeness
scenarios are introduced and show how data obtained from the Linear Logic proof trees can be used to guide the execution of such scenarios. / Este trabalho formaliza quatro métodos baseados na Lógica Linear para verificação
de processos de workflow interorganizacionais modelados por WorkFlow nets interorganizacionais,
que são redes de Petri que modelam tais processos. O primeiro método está
relacionado com a verificação do critério de correção Soundness para processos de workflow
interorganizacionais. O método é baseado na construção e análise de árvores de prova
da Lógica Linear que representam tanto os processos locais quanto o processo global. O
segundo e terceiro métodos estão relacionados, respectivamente, com a verificação dos
critérios de correção Relaxed Soundness e Weak Soundness para processos de workflow interorganizacionais,
e são obtidos através da análise de árvores de prova da Lógica Linear
reutilizadas, construídas para a prova do critério de correção Soundness. Já o quarto método
tem por objetivo a detecção dos cenários livres de deadlock em processos de workflow
interorganizacionais e é baseado na construção e análise de árvores de prova da Lógica
Linear que consideram, inicialmente, os processos locais e as comunicações entre estes e,
posteriormente, os cenários candidatos.
Um estudo de caso é realizado no contexto da verificação de composições de serviços
Web, uma vez que há uma relação estreita entre a modelagem de um processo de
workflow interorganizacional e uma composição de serviços Web. Assim, os quatro métodos
propostos no contexto dos processos de workflow interorganizacionais são aplicados
a uma composição de serviços Web. A avaliação dos resultados mostra que o reuso de
árvores de prova da Lógica Linear construídas inicialmente para a prova do critério de
correção Soundness de fato ocorre no contexto da verificação dos critérios de correção
Relaxed Soundness e Weak Soundness. Além disso, a avaliação mostra como os sequentes
da Lógica Linear e suas árvores de prova explicitam as possibilidades de colaboração
existentes em uma composição de serviços Web. Uma avaliação que leva em conta o número
de árvores de prova da Lógica Linear construídas mostra que este número pode ser
significativamente reduzido no método para detecção de cenários livres de deadlock. Uma abordagem para planejamento de recursos, baseada no cálculo de datas simbólicas,
que considera dados extraídos de árvores de prova da Lógica Linear, é apresentada e validada através de simulações realizadas no simulador CPN Tools. Duas abordagens
para a monitoração dos cenários livres de deadlock são introduzidas e mostram como
dados obtidos nas árvores de prova da Lógica Linear podem ser utilizados para guiar a
execução de tais cenários. / Doutor em Ciência da Computação
|
Page generated in 0.1489 seconds